Two College Students Aim to Connect People Across the World with Zaang

Under30CEO.com posted on February 06, 2010

Michael Markarian and Alex Kravets founded Zaang in 2007 while students at Babson College. They saw tremendous opportunity in bringing people together who share something in common – something lacking in the social networking and microblogging space.

Get A Room Already

trueslant.com posted on February 02, 2010

Michael Markarian was an undergrad at Babson College in 2007, sitting around with friends in his dorm room, when the idea for a social networking site called Zaang came to him. Zaang, as defined by urbandictionary.com, is "something that is both awesome and amazing (which is why there are two a's)." Yesterday Zaang went live...

Invites - Zaang Wants To Host Your Topical Conversations

thenextweb.com posted on January 22, 2010

Zaang, a company that is still in private beta, is out to reorganize the way that you discuss topics. The company is centering discussions in individual 'worlds', which are similar to FriendFeed rooms without the real-time aspect. Each room has a main genre, such as Poker.
